What a Man (2011)
What a man is a comedy that tells the story of a young professor, Alex (Matthias Schweighofer), who after being left by his girlfriend Caroline (Mavie Hörbiger), begins a journey to know himself. But how do you overcome the difficulties of a man today? Or rather what is it that makes a man a man?
